Within 5 days of the appointment of the actuary, the insurer must provide to the Commissioner which information?

Explanation:
Notification requirements for appointing an actuary require the insurer to provide the Commissioner the actuary’s name and title, the manner of appointment, and a statement that the person meets the requirements to be a qualified actuary. Knowing the name and title lets the regulator identify who is in charge of the actuarial function. The manner of appointment explains how that person came into the role, which speaks to governance, independence, and proper authorization. The statement that the person meets the requirements to be a qualified actuary confirms that the individual has the necessary credentials and status under the applicable rules. Together, these items give the Commissioner a clear, complete picture of who is performing the actuarial duties, how they were chosen, and that they are appropriately qualified. Providing all three pieces within the five-day window ensures timely, accurate regulatory oversight and up-to-date records. If any piece were missing, the regulator might not be able to verify identity, governance, or qualification, which could hinder supervision and risk assessment.

Understanding the Exam Format

CAS Exam 6 is designed to evaluate an individual's knowledge and expertise in topics crucial to the casualty actuarial profession. This exam focuses on the regulation and financial reporting pertinent to insurance entities.

Exam Structure

  • Format: The CAS Exam 6 follows a written-answer format, which means examinees are required to write their responses rather than choosing from set multiple-choice answers.
  • Duration: The exam is typically a 4-hour session, testing endurance alongside intellectual prowess.
  • Coverage: It assesses knowledge in areas such as insurance accounting, regulation, taxation, and financial reporting.

Key Areas of Focus

  1. Insurance Exposure and Booking Models
  2. Regulatory Environment and Enterprise Risk Management
  3. Actuarial Professionalism
  4. Principles of Insurance Financial Reporting
  5. Statistical Methods for Insurance Analysis
